Susanne Rita Bachmaier (* 1968 , née Stanglmeier) is a qualified social worker and Bavarian politician ( ÖDP ) from Anzing .

In 1989 she was one of the founders of the ödp district association in Erding, of which she was deputy chairman until 1996. Then she was district chairwoman there until 1998. In 1997 she was elected as the new Ödp federal chairman in a voting against incumbent Hans Mangold with 141 out of 267 votes. She was the top candidate of her party for the 1998 Bundestag election and the 1999 European election . She was confirmed in office at the 15th Federal Party Congress on September 18 and 19, 1999 in Berlin. Due to the lack of electoral success of her party and a lack of party-internal approval for an organizational development process initiated by the federal executive committee, she resigned from her position at the end of 2000. The new federal chairman was the Würzburg economic criminal and publisher Uwe Dolata . Until 2014 she was the only woman who held this position.

From 2002 to 2004 she was a member of the district council of the district of Erding ; she resigned from this office after moving to Munich for professional reasons .

She has lived in Ecuador since the end of 2008 , where she initially worked as the director of a home project for neglected children and later as a project manager for school and training projects in community development. After professional positions as a project manager for school projects in rural areas, the management of a local distance learning center for a renowned private university and the management of various projects in the field of work for the disabled, she was briefly involved in developing and consolidating local social policy with a focus on protection after a change of local government power in her place of residence entrusted to the rights of disadvantaged groups. At the beginning of 2015 she switched to school social work, where she worked in a rural community at a state full school institution (pre-school to high school graduation) and in 2016 in various schools in Quito. She has been living in Quito since March 2016 and from August 2016 to the beginning of 2018 headed the social work department in the Quito-Süd district of the Ministry of Social Affairs and was also temporarily director of the district.

Since 2010 as a part-time job, she has been running her own consulting company "YUYAY Consultoría Integral" since 2018 in her own consulting rooms in the south of Quito and offers systemic, psychosocial and therapeutic advice and coaching for schoolchildren / young people, parents, couples and families, as well as coaching for Executives and competitive athletes, organizational development, project management and social work in general.

She is a fan of TSV 1860 Munich and SD Aucas ( Quito ), and in Quito co-founder of the non-profit association for social work "Fundación Desarrollo, Inclusión y Compromiso Social FUNDICS" as well as initiator and founding chair of the also non-profit association "Fundación Amigos del Ídolo", who supports the promotion of young talent, fan work and the social and community-oriented commitment of the SD Aucas.
